
Hardback
Published 24 May 2007
441 results
Hardback
Published 24 May 2007
Hardback
Published 19 Jan 2009
Hardback
Published 01 Sep 1992
Hardback
Published 28 Oct 1999
Paperback
Published 01 Jan 1978
Paperback
Published 12 Mar 2007
Paperback
Published 03 Jun 1995
Paperback
Published 17 Nov 2011
Hardback
Published 18 Jun 2005
Hardback
Published 11 Dec 2001
Paperback
Published 24 Jun 1999
Paperback
Published 11 Aug 2005
Paperback
Published 06 Jun 2007
Paperback
Published 24 Oct 2003
Hardback
Published 13 Apr 1995
Paperback
Published 01 Jan 1993
Hardback
Published 11 Aug 2005
Hardback
Published 24 Jun 1999
Hardback
Published 05 Mar 2020
Book
Published 01 Jan 1988
Paperback
Published 15 Feb 2016
Paperback
Published 01 Jan 2002
Hardback
Published 11 Nov 2004
Hardback
Published 11 Nov 2004
Hardback
Published 11 Nov 2004
Hardback
Published 11 Nov 2004
Paperback
Published 31 Dec 1996
Paperback
Published 31 Oct 2002
Paperback
Published 01 Jan 2012
Paperback
Published 30 Jul 1999
Paperback
Published 09 May 2000
Paperback
Published 01 Jan 2007
Hardback
Published 23 May 2016
Hardback
Published 01 Jul 1992
Paperback
Published 29 Apr 1982
Paperback
Published 01 Jan 2014
Book
Published 08 May 1980
Book
Published 01 Jan 1994
Book
Published 01 Apr 1975
Book
Published 01 Jan 2008
Book
Published 01 Jan 2016
Book
Published 01 Jan 2017
Book
Published 01 Jan 2016
Book
Published 01 Jan 2017
Book
Published 01 Jan 2009
Book
Published 01 Jan 2010
Book
Published 01 Jan 2016
Book
Published 01 Jan 2016
Book
Published 01 Jan 2010
Book
Published 01 Jan 2018
Book
Published 01 Jan 2010
Book
Published 01 Jan 2010
Book
Published 01 Aug 2021
Book
Published 01 Jan 2011
Book
Book
Published 15 Oct 1999
Book
Published 14 Sep 1989
Book
Book
Published 01 Jan 2005
Book
Published 01 Jan 1975